Steps to Update the Subaru Head Unit Software

Keeping your Subaru’s head unit software up-to-date is a key aspect of ensuring full-screen Android Auto functionality. The process may vary slightly depending on your vehicle model, but the general steps remain consistent.

  1. Check for Updates: Access your Subaru’s infotainment system settings. Look for an option related to software updates. This could be located in the “System,” “About,” or “Software Update” section.
  2. Download the Update: If an update is available, the system will usually prompt you to download it. This may require a Wi-Fi connection, so ensure your vehicle is connected to a reliable network.
  3. Initiate the Installation: Once the download is complete, the system will prompt you to install the update. Follow the on-screen instructions. This process may take some time, and it’s essential to avoid interrupting the installation. The head unit may restart during this process.
  4. Verification: After the installation, the system should restart. Verify that the update was successful by checking the software version in the “About” or “System Information” section again.

Connection Issues

Connection problems are arguably the most frustrating hurdle in the full-screen Android Auto experience. The good news is, they’re often fixable with a little detective work. These issues can range from a simple cable problem to more complex software conflicts.

First, consider the humble USB cable. It’s the lifeline of your connection, and a faulty one is a common culprit. A worn or damaged cable might transmit power but not data, or it might intermittently cut out, leading to frustrating disconnections. A high-quality USB cable, specifically one designed for data transfer, is your best bet. Avoid using generic or old cables, and always ensure it’s securely plugged into both your phone and the Subaru’s USB port.

It’s like having a leaky water hose – no matter how good the water source (your phone), you won’t get a proper flow (Android Auto).

Next, let’s explore your phone. Is it up to date? Outdated software can create compatibility conflicts. Ensure your Android operating system and the Android Auto app are running the latest versions. Similarly, check for any updates for your Subaru’s infotainment system.

Vehicle manufacturers regularly release updates that improve performance and fix bugs, often addressing connection problems. Think of it like a software patch that closes vulnerabilities and optimizes performance.

Finally, consider the possibility of interference. Other electronic devices in your car can sometimes interfere with the Bluetooth or Wi-Fi signals used by Android Auto. Try disconnecting any unnecessary Bluetooth devices and see if that resolves the issue. Also, ensure your phone isn’t too far away from the head unit. In some instances, the signal can be blocked by certain materials.

Audio Problems and Distorted Display Issues

Once you’ve successfully connected, you might encounter audio glitches or display distortions. These issues can range from a simple volume adjustment to more involved troubleshooting steps. Let’s delve into these potential problems.

Audio problems often manifest as crackling, popping, or complete silence. The first step is to check your volume settings on both your phone and the Subaru’s infotainment system. Make sure the volume isn’t muted or turned down too low. Also, verify that the audio output is correctly routed to your car’s speakers. Sometimes, the system might default to another audio source, like your phone’s speaker.

Another potential source of audio issues lies in the Android Auto app itself. Try clearing the app’s cache and data. This can resolve corrupted files that might be causing the audio problems. To do this, go to your phone’s settings, find the Android Auto app, and select “Storage.” Then, tap “Clear cache” and “Clear data.” This is akin to resetting a computer program to its factory settings.

Distorted display issues can range from blurry images to flickering screens. Start by checking your phone’s screen resolution settings. If the resolution is set too high, it might cause display problems, especially on older infotainment systems. Try lowering the resolution and see if the distortion disappears. Furthermore, check the display settings within the Android Auto app itself, and ensure that the settings are optimized for your vehicle’s screen size.

In rare cases, display issues could be linked to the infotainment system’s firmware. If you’ve tried all other solutions, consider updating the system’s software. As mentioned earlier, manufacturers often release updates that improve performance and resolve bugs, including display problems. It is like updating the drivers for your computer’s video card; it can dramatically improve performance and fix visual glitches.

Using Google Assistant with Full-Screen Android Auto

The Google Assistant seamlessly integrates with full-screen Android Auto, allowing you to control various functions without taking your hands off the wheel or your eyes off the road. Activation is typically achieved through a button on your steering wheel or by using the “Hey Google” or “Okay Google” wake phrases. Once activated, the Assistant listens for your commands and executes them accordingly.

Functionality of Voice Commands

The capabilities of voice commands within Android Auto are extensive, enhancing both safety and convenience. Let’s break down some key functionalities:

  • Navigation: Direct the Google Assistant to navigate to a destination using voice commands. For example, “Navigate to the nearest coffee shop,” or “Take me home.” The Assistant will then provide turn-by-turn directions, displaying them prominently on your full-screen display. You can also ask for alternative routes or information about traffic conditions along your route.
  • Music: Control your music playback with simple voice commands. Say things like, “Play my favorite playlist,” “Play some rock music,” or “Skip this song.” The Assistant interacts with various music streaming services, offering a vast library of music at your fingertips.
  • Communication: Manage your calls and text messages hands-free. You can say, “Call Mom,” or “Text John, ‘I’m running late.'” The Assistant will then initiate the call or read aloud the incoming text message, allowing you to reply using your voice.
